GearmanWorker::setTimeout
(PECL gearman >= 0.6.0)
GearmanWorker::setTimeout — Завдання часу очікування на введення/виведення на сокеті
Опис
public GearmanWorker::setTimeout(int $timeout): true
Встановлює час очікування на активність на сокеті.
Список параметрів
timeout
Тимчасовий інтервал у мілісекундах. Негативне значення вказує на відсутність обмежень.
Значення, що повертаються
Функція завжди повертає true
Приклади
Приклад #1 Простий обробник із п'ятисекундним часом очікування
Loading...
Якщо запустити цей обробник і не передавати йому завдань, висновок буде таким:
Запуск
Ожидание задания...
Время вышло. Ожидание следующего задания...
Время вышло. Ожидание следующего задания...
Время вышло. Ожидание следующего задания...
Дивіться також
- GearmanWorker::timeout() - Отримання значення час очікування запитів на сокеті